Taoist Tai Chi Awareness Day Parade
More than 1,000 members of the Fung Loy Kok International Taoist Tai Chi Society—the largest nonprofit tai chi organization in the world, headquartered in Toronto—will gather on Yonge-Dundas Square for a visually stunning parade, demonstration, tand celebration of the Taoist Tai Chi™ internal arts of health.
